This sounds simular to the null file system. It simply takes one part of
the file system, and puts a copy some where else. However, this approch
uses a layered file system and Apple hightly suggests not using layered
file systems. But it might be worth the risk in it breaking depending on
your goals.
It's a little tricky to do this since copying an entire file from within a
VFS stack can be non-trivial.

This is a very nullfs like thing to do, you'd cover the real vnode with
one from nullfs, and have nullfs redirct the operations to the appropriate
file by swaping around vnodes.
If you're only planning on supporting HFS/HFS+, I might suggest just
copying outright the HFS+ source, convert it to a kext, and make it
override the normal HFS+ matching and add whatever bits to make it work
there, which would avoid the layering problem.
